/* RCSid: $Id: sm_stree.h,v 3.7 2003/07/14 22:24:00 schorsch Exp $ */ /* * sm_stree.h - header file for spherical quadtree code: * */ #ifndef _RAD_SM_STREE_H_ #define _RAD_SM_STREE_H_ #ifdef __cplusplus extern "C" { #endif #define STR_INDEX(s) (stRoot_indices[(s)]) #define STR_NTH_INDEX(s,n) (stRoot_indices[(s)][(n)]) #define ST_NUM_ROOT_NODES 8 /* The base is an octahedron: Each face contains a planar quadtree. At the root level, the "top" (positive y) four faces, and bottom four faces are stored together:forming two root quadtree nodes */ typedef struct _STREE { QUADTREE qt[2]; /* root[0]= top four faces, root[1]=bottom 4 faces*/ }STREE; #define ST_BASEI(n) ((n)>>2) /* root index: top or bottom */ #define ST_INDEX(n) ((n) & 0x3) /* which child in root */ #define ST_QT(s,i) ((s)->qt[ST_BASEI(i)]) /* top or bottom root*/ #define ST_QT_PTR(s,i) (&ST_QT(s,i)) /* ptr to top(0)/bottom(1)root*/ #define ST_TOP_QT(s) ((s)->qt[0]) /* top root (y>0)*/ #define ST_BOTTOM_QT(s) ((s)->qt[1]) /* bottom qt (y <= 0)*/ #define ST_TOP_QT_PTR(s) (&ST_TOP_QT(s)) /* ptr to top qt */ #define ST_BOTTOM_QT_PTR(s) (&ST_BOTTOM_QT(s)) /* ptr to bottom qt*/ #define ST_NTH_V(s,n,w) (stDefault_base[stBase_verts[n][w]]) #define ST_ROOT_QT(s,n) QT_NTH_CHILD(ST_QT(s,n),ST_INDEX(n)) #define ST_CLEAR_QT(st) (ST_TOP_QT(st)=EMPTY,ST_BOTTOM_QT(st)=EMPTY) #define ST_INIT_QT(st) (QT_CLEAR_CHILDREN(ST_TOP_QT(st)), \ QT_CLEAR_CHILDREN(ST_BOTTOM_QT(st))) #define ST_CLEAR_FLAGS(s) qtClearAllFlags() /* Point location based on coordinate signs */ #define stLocate_root(p) (((p)[2]>0.0?0:4)|((p)[1]>0.0?0:2)|((p)[0]>0.0?0:1)) #define stClear(st) stInit(st) #define ST_CLIP_VERTS 16 /* STREE functions void stInit(STREE *st,FVECT center) Initializes an stree structure with origin 'center': Frees existing quadtrees hanging off of the roots STREE *stAlloc(STREE *st) Allocates a stree structure and creates octahedron base QUADTREE stPoint_locate(STREE *st,FVECT p) Returns quadtree leaf node containing point 'p'. int stAdd_tri(STREE *st,int id,FVECT t0,t1,t2) Add triangle 'id' with coordinates 't0,t1,t2' to the stree: returns FALSE on error, TRUE otherwise int stRemove_tri(STREE *st,int id,FVECT t0,t1,t2) Removes triangle 'id' with coordinates 't0,t1,t2' from stree: returns FALSE on error, TRUE otherwise int stTrace_ray(STREE *st,FVECT orig,dir,int (*func)(),int *arg1,*arg2) Trace ray 'orig-dir' through stree and apply 'func(arg1,arg2)' at each node that it intersects int stApply_to_tri(STREE *st,FVECT t0,t1,t2,int (*edge_func)(), (*tri_func)(),int arg1,*arg2) Visit nodes intersected by tri 't0,t1,t2'.Apply 'edge_func(arg1,arg2,arg3)', to those nodes intersected by edges, and interior_func to ALL nodes: ie some Nodes will be visited more than once */ extern int stBase_verts[8][3]; extern FVECT stDefault_base[6]; extern STREE *stAlloc(); extern QUADTREE stPoint_locate(); #ifdef __cplusplus } #endif #endif /* _RAD_SM_STREE_H_ */
